UnDecided
~ By Sue ~

I wonder if it showed
The fear I felt inside
When he asked me out
I never did decide

I haven't been out in quite a while
Really I had no intentions to
To get involved once again
I don't know if I can do

Tall, dark and rather handsom
He likes to go fishing too
He said to choose where I wanted to go
I told him that I have no clue

I could feel myself shaking inside
It has been way too long for me
A little afraid, maybe alot
I never did answer, you see

9-26-03
